Birds, beetles and butterflies: conservationists reveal wildlife affected by UK fires

Summary by ethicalmarketingnews.com
The National Trust has laid bare some of the varied species of wildlife that have been affected by April’s spate of wildfires. After the driest March in decades, and warmer than average temperatures in April, the UK has had one of the worst fire seasons on record.
